An unusual 12-bore boxlock ejector gun by Charles Ingram, no. AK153

The sides of the action-body with foliate-scroll engraving, arcaded fences, well-figured replacement stock with ebonite butt-plate, the ribless barrels engraved Charles Ingram, 10 Waterloo St., Glasgow
Weight 6lb. 6¼oz., 14¾in. pull (14½in. stock), 26in. barrels, approx. cyl. & ¾ choke, 2½in. chambers, Birmingham nitro reproof

Footnotes

According to Nigel Brown's British Gunmakers, Vol. Two, Charles Ingram was at this address between 1924 and 1946. The vendor showed this gun to Geoffrey Boothroyd, who believed this to be one of only two ribless shotguns that Charles Ingram ever built
